In their own words

So I've owned two Seat Ateca's so far. I've had the 190ps petrol and diesel in DSG. Both have been trouble free. I really can't complain about this SUV. The practically is great and it's so comfortable, especially on long distances. The seats cater for my big legs in respect of width. Paired with the heated element, it is awesome! The car has a large boot and easy to fold the rear seats down. 475 L with the AWD model is more that enough for me. You get more with the 2WD option. I've had no rattles from a cabin. The Ateca has harder sportier suspension, and is easy to fire in and out of bends, if that's your thing! On the other side it also gives you loads of confidence. MPG can be as low at 25 or as high as 40, this is all depending on driving in Eco mode where the gear disengages and you coast, or in sport which hold a lower gear for longer. You'll find the throttle pedal will be very unresponsive in Eco mode however. If you are into your technology, you can use an OBD tool and change the throttle response, which has improved the car loads in my opinion.
